OPAPP visits PAMANA projects in the 3 towns of Camarines Norte By: Rosalita B. Manlangit DAET, Camarines Norte, Sept. 4 (PIA) – The Office of the Presidential Adviser on the Peace Process (OPAPP) has conducted a series of inter-agency field visits to farm to market roads and bridges projects in the towns of Labo, Capalonga and Jose Panganiban recently in this province. The projects are under the PAyapa at MAsaganang PamayaNAn (PAMANA) of the OPAPP, a national government’s program that extends development interventions to isolated, hard to reach and conflict-affected communities, ensuring that they are not left behind. OPAPP Communications Unit director Polly Michelle Cunanan said that this is in connection with the recently concluded communication workshop with the agency’s goal to intensify efforts in showcasing PAMANA, how it has improved people’s lives and communities with the end goal to increase the public’s awareness, appreciation and understanding of PAMANA, as the government program and framework for peace and development in conflict-affected areas. She said that the inter-agency field visits documented success stories among the identified projects sites in the three towns of the province. Cunanan said that the activity aimed to strengthen collaboration with partner agencies as embodied in the PAMANA convergence framework. She said that among the projects visited are concreting of farm to market roads (FMRs) in barangays Malibago to Malaya and Maot; Kapit Bisig Laban sa Kahirapan-Comprehensive Integrated Delivery of Social Service (KALAHI-CIDDS) and PAMANA projects in brgys. Maot and Bautista; and concreting and gravelling of Exciban to Nalisbitan to Dumagmang farm to market roads all in Labo town. The other projects are construction of bridges in Old Camp, Binawangan to Calabaca, Binawangan to del Pilar in Capalonga town; and concreting of Sta. Rosa Sur to San Rafael and San Isidro to Sta. Cruz farm to market roads in Jose Panganiban. The PAMANA started in this province in 2011 with the projects amounting to P140M funded by the OPAPP in the towns of Mercedes, Jose Panganiban and Labo while in 2012 in the amount of P20M funded by the Department of Interior and Local Government (DILG) in the towns of Labo, Jose Panganiban and Capalonga. The allocation of 106M for 2013 PAMANA projects was funded by the DILG, Department of Agriculture (DA), and National Irrigation Administration (NIA) in the towns of Basud, Capalonga, San Lorenzo Ruiz and Sta. Elena. This year’s PAMANA under DILG allocated some P81M covering five municipalities namely Basud, Capalonga, Labo, Mercedes and Sta. Elena. Only Camarines Norte has the allocation from the DILG for the PAMANA projects in the Bicol Region. Recently the Provincial Peace and Order Council (PPOC) also endorsed some P36M worth of farm to market road projects to the DA for PAMANA 2014 in the towns of Capalonga and San Lorenzo Ruiz.
